Wow, Naches has some awsome views and even wilder runs, We ran Manastash Ridge Trail, down 4w309 and turn right onto 4W330 then visited moons rocks for a bit and went to camp.

Ruby`s bumper and oil pan took some damage other than that it was a great run, we have an oil pan skid plate on order.
